From: Aggregatibacter actinomycetemcomitans H-NS promotes biofilm formation and alters protein dynamics of other species within a polymicrobial oral biofilm

Fig. 1

Assessment of the influence of H-NS on A. actinomycetemcomitans cell morphology and monoculture biofilm formation. Atomic force microscopy was used to analyze the following A. actinomycetemcomitans strains, cultivated on agar at the indicated temperatures: D7S 30 °C (a), D7S hns 30 °C (b), D7S 37 °C (c), and D7S hns 37 °C (d). Arrows indicate examples of the released OMVs. Scale bars = 500 nm. Crystal violet was used to quantify the biofilm formation of the strains D7S and D7S hns, respectively, after cultivation in 24-well cell culture plates for 3 days at 37 °C (e). Shown are the means of OD 590 nm ± standard deviation (SD) for six experiments; *p= 0.0169 for D7S vs. D7S hns
